Output d81600c5e5c75015f9bb2249e01b9c6eed4135c08e7a8f61abdd66ec9d9a9bce:0

value
24940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c964e0f19e9471f006a0fbcf2c2c20b87881a1fa OP_EQUAL
address
3L3tbGwjVx1MAFHyjkRVi828e4mkxftKxX
transaction
d81600c5e5c75015f9bb2249e01b9c6eed4135c08e7a8f61abdd66ec9d9a9bce
spent
true